SCOPE
Capability snapshot: 2026-08-23.
INTENT.mdstates the destination and boundaries; this file records what the repository currently implements and has evidence for.
One-liner
rein-aharness is the Claude-Code-CLI-oriented rein that claims scheduled
Activity Core work, routes versioned execution profiles through Glas, and
retains a legacy set of local task executors for unattended repository work.
Implemented capability
Intake and lifecycle
- The primary production intake is the Activity Core
ops_runREST queue. The worker filters and claims rows, heartbeats their lease, and completes or fails them with normalized result data. - A queued
harness_profile_refis authoritative. The worker carries its allowlisted attribution refs into a GlasExecutionRequest, uses governed actoragt, returns the completeGatewayResult, and never falls back to a legacy approach after profile refusal or failure. - Profile-absent rows use the coexistence registry in
approaches.py. Unmatched rows fail visibly. JSON task files remain available for local development, and issue-core polling remains as a legacy compatibility path. - The production claim loop is a single-concurrency user systemd service on railiance01. Claim failures use the configured poll interval and active runs receive lease heartbeats.
Execution paths
- Generic local
TaskSpecruns resolve instance policy, optionally load a kaizen-agentic persona bundle, invoke Claude Code in the target checkout, impose a wall-clock timeout and named Claude tool allow-list, and require a new GitHEADbefore reporting success. - Optional Claude stream JSON is reduced to tool/hook audit events and can be reported to State Hub.
- Versioned profiled rows delegate profile, rein, model, tool, sandbox, and
teardown decisions to Glas/sand-boxer.
rein-aharnessowns the queue adapter, not the meta-framework or sandbox implementation. - Legacy structured executors produce Freedom Intelligence daily research briefs, Binky daily/weekly briefs, deterministic mailbox scans, and mailbox triage. The LLM-backed structured paths use the llm-connect HTTP service; mailbox credential acquisition is a bounded OpenBao/AppRole pre-step.
- A deterministic smoke path can clone a controlled sandbox repository,
commit
SMOKE.md, optionally push it, and report evidence without invoking Claude.
Declarative policy and reporting
.kaizen/schedule.ymlparsing and validation cover cadence, enabled state, blueprint name, green/blue lane, named tool profile, token budget, and harness-major pin. Strict validation requires the runtime fields for enabled instances.- The local profile registry contains
green-commit-onlyandblue-mail-triage. Unknown profiles fail closed. Both restrict the Claude session to repository read/edit operations and selected local Git commands; lane itself is metadata and consistency validation, not an OS security boundary. - Runs can append
.kaizen/metrics/<agent>/executions.jsonl, regenerate the summary, emit State Hub progress/tool/token events, and close an associated Hub task. These reporting operations are best-effort. - llm-connect HTTP errors retain only bounded, allowlisted provider diagnosis.
Packaging and deployment
- The Python package and CLI are version
0.1.0; Glas and sand-boxer are optional sibling runtime dependencies. - The host deployment includes a user-service claim loop and helpers for resolving in-cluster Activity Core, llm-connect, and State Hub services.
- A container image and hardened Kubernetes manifests exist. The Kubernetes
Deployment currently runs
sleep infinity; it validates packaging and image availability but is not the production claim worker.
Current evidence and limits
- The historical 2026-07-26 proof exercised a real Claude CLI session and commit through the then-current coarse Glas rein contract. The deterministic Railiance smoke also proved clone, commit, optional push, and Hub reporting.
- The current profiled queue adapter is deployed at
c633291. Production runededc939-266f-473c-8386-ffd3f027f5f0proved profile/ref preservation, governed actor mapping, resolution, normalized failure, and sandbox teardown. It failed closed atsession_startbefore Claude dispatch or commit because executable bwrap reachability, mounted rein runtime, and model egress remain with upstream residualGLAS-IN-0002. - Direct legacy agent sessions rely on Claude Code's own tool mediation and the host checkout. They are not an OS-level sandbox, do not lock the repo, and do not prove that no push/network activity occurred after the run.
- Commit acceptance currently means only that
HEADchanged. It does not yet validate the changed-file set, branch/parent shape, clean working tree, remote state, or provenance of the new commit. Metrics are written after this check and can leave target-repo changes for a later commit. - The worker is sequential and repository mapping is host configuration. There is no multi-worker repository lease, per-tenant process isolation, generic credential broker, or tenant onboarding API.
- Freedom Intelligence and Binky approach matching, output formats, event names, mailbox paths, and one default push behavior are tenant-specific compatibility code. They are implemented capability, but conflict with the intended generic-runtime boundary and should not be the pattern for new tenants.
Explicit boundaries
- Scheduling and activity definitions belong to Activity Core.
- Blueprint authoring and improvement loops belong to kaizen-agentic.
- Profile routing and rein selection belong to Glas.
- Sandbox lifecycle and isolation belong to sand-boxer.
- Provider abstraction belongs to llm-connect.
- Durable work history and decisions belong to State Hub; agent memory and metrics remain in the consuming repository.
